How it Calculates the Results

The calculator uses the Harris-Benedict equation to calculate the Basal Metabolic Rate (BMR). The BMR is then adjusted based on the activity level to estimate your daily calorie needs:

  • The Harris-Benedict equations are:
    • For men: BMR = 66 + (6.3 * weight) + (12.9 * height) – (6.8 * age)
    • For women: BMR = 655 + (4.3 * weight) + (4.7 * height) – (4.7 * age)
  • Activity levels and their multipliers:
    • Sedentary: BMR * 1.2
    • Lightly active: BMR * 1.375
    • Moderately active: BMR * 1.55
    • Active: BMR * 1.725
    • Very active: BMR * 1.9

Limitations

Note that this calculator provides an estimate based on average values and does not take into account specific metabolic conditions or illnesses. It is always best to consult a nutritionist or a healthcare professional for personalized advice.
